noun \ˈtəsh\Definition of TUSH
: a long pointed tooth; especially : a horse's canine
Origin of TUSH
Middle English tusch, from Old English tūsc; akin to OldFrisian tusk tooth, Old English tōth tooth
First Known Use: before 12th century
